Federal Reserve Rate Decisions and Interest Rate Transmission: How 2026 Policy Shifts Impact HOOK Token Valuation

Federal Reserve rate decisions operate through established transmission channels that directly influence cryptocurrency valuations and market liquidity conditions. When the central bank adjusts policy rates, these changes ripple through traditional financial markets before affecting alternative assets like HOOK tokens. The transmission mechanism begins with shifts in the cost of capital—lower interest rates reduce borrowing costs and increase the appeal of risk assets, including digital tokens, as investors seek higher returns in a lower-yield environment.

Liquidity represents the primary channel linking monetary policy to HOOK token price movements. During periods when the Federal Reserve pursues accommodative policies through rate cuts, increased liquidity flows into risk-on assets. Market data shows that crypto assets, particularly altcoins, respond positively when investors exhibit elevated risk appetite following Fed rate reductions. However, this relationship exhibits temporal delays; economists note that the full impact of policy shifts typically materializes over multiple quarters rather than immediately.

The transmission of Fed decisions to HOOK valuation also depends on inflation expectations and real interest rates. When inflation data surprises to the upside, market participants anticipate potential rate hikes, causing near-term selling pressure across crypto markets. Conversely, when inflation moderates, supporting further rate cuts, HOOK and similar tokens benefit from renewed institutional and retail interest in higher-yielding digital assets.

Investor sentiment functions as a critical amplification mechanism. Fed communications and forward guidance shape market expectations, influencing capital allocation decisions. As the Federal Reserve's 2026 policy framework becomes clearer through successive announcements and inflation readings, HOOK token valuations will increasingly reflect anticipated monetary conditions and their implications for broader cryptocurrency adoption.

Recent analysis reveals a complex relationship between inflation metrics and HOOK token performance that challenges conventional hedge assumptions. While U.S. core CPI decelerated to 2.6% through 2025—its slowest pace since March 2021—HOOK price movement demonstrated insufficient correlation with these CPI trends, fluctuating independently despite significant macroeconomic shifts.

However, HOOK exhibits pronounced sensitivity to CPI announcement surprises themselves. The token consistently experiences substantial intraday and weekly volatility spikes coinciding with inflation data releases, suggesting traders actively position ahead of these economic indicators. This reaction pattern indicates that while HOOK may not function as a traditional inflation hedge comparable to Bitcoin or Ethereum, it serves as a tactical trading vehicle around macroeconomic uncertainty events.

The volatility magnitude typically correlates with the magnitude of CPI surprise—larger deviations from expectations trigger more pronounced HOOK price swings. This dynamic presents opportunities for traders monitoring inflation data releases, though the lack of sustained correlation means HOOK cannot reliably protect portfolios against prolonged inflationary periods or economic uncertainty. Instead, HOOK traders should view CPI announcements as catalysts for short-term price movements rather than fundamental drivers of long-term value appreciation.

Traditional Market Volatility Spillover: S&P 500 and Gold Price Fluctuations as Leading Indicators for HOOK Token Dynamics

Volatility spillovers from traditional financial markets significantly influence HOOK token price movements, creating measurable lead-lag relationships that researchers actively monitor. When S&P 500 experiences sharp declines, comparable volatility often emerges in cryptocurrency markets within days, suggesting that equity market stress serves as a leading indicator for digital asset reassessment. This phenomenon reflects how institutional capital flows between asset classes during periods of uncertainty.

Gold prices function as a particularly revealing signal for HOOK token dynamics. During economic turmoil, gold's safe haven status traditionally strengthens while equities decline—yet cryptocurrencies exhibit mixed responses. Research employing DCC-GARCH and Diebold-Yilmaz spillover index methodologies reveals that gold price fluctuations demonstrably influence HOOK volatility, though the transmission mechanisms prove more nuanced than simple correlation suggests. When Federal Reserve signals suggest tightening monetary policy, gold typically appreciates while HOOK token exhibits heightened volatility as traders reassess growth prospects.

Empirical studies examining cross-market spillovers between 2022–2026 indicate that S&P 500 volatility Granger-causes HOOK token returns, establishing predictive utility for traders. However, this relationship weakens during extreme market dislocations, when cryptocurrency dynamics decouple from traditional assets. The complexity intensifies because HOOK token responses reflect not only direct volatility transmission but also changing market sentiment regarding Federal Reserve policy implications—making traditional market movements imperfect but useful leading indicators for cryptocurrency price forecasting.

What is HOOK token and what are its practical use cases?

HOOK is the governance token of Hooked Protocol, enabling community voting on platform decisions. It serves as the gas token for DApps built on the platform, with transaction fees paid in HOOK, creating utility-driven demand.
